Navigating the Cuts

As we filmed, the One Big Beautiful Bill Act was passed, leading to historic cuts to Medicaid. California faced a potential loss of $30 billion annually for Medi-Cal. St. John's leadership navigated the financial storm, advocating for a sales tax to raise funds for healthcare. Despite initial setbacks, the measure passed, a victory for the county's poorest neighborhoods.

The Road Ahead

While this documentary chapter has ended, the story continues. Experts warn of further service cuts and longer wait times. The need for healthcare funding remains, and difficult choices lie ahead for counties across California.
